Nonetheless, initially a quick description of Indexed Universal Life Insurance Policy. The tourist attraction of IUL is obvious. The premise is that you (virtually) obtain the returns of the equity market, without any risk of losing money. Currently, prior to you drop off your chair laughing at the absurdity of that declaration, you require to recognize they make a very convincing argument, at the very least until you check out the information and understand you don't get anywhere near the returns of the equity market, and you're paying far excessive for the warranties you're obtaining.
If the market decreases, you get the assured return, typically something in between 0 and 3%. Obviously, given that it's an insurance plan, there are additionally the common costs of insurance coverage, compensations, and abandonment costs to pay. The details, and the reasons that returns are so terrible when blending insurance policy and investing in this particular method, come down to basically three things: They just pay you for the return of the index, and not the dividends.
If you cap is 10%, and the return of the S&P 500 index fund is 30% (like last year), you obtain 10%, not 30%. If the Index Fund goes up 12%, and 2% of that is returns, the adjustment in the index is 10%.
Add all these effects together, and you'll locate that long-lasting returns on index universal life are rather darn near to those for whole life insurance coverage, favorable, however reduced. Yes, these plans ensure that the cash value (not the cash that mosts likely to the costs of insurance, of course) will certainly not lose cash, but there is no assurance it will stay up to date with rising cost of living, a lot less expand at the rate you require it to grow at in order to offer your retired life.
Koreis's 16 factors: An indexed universal life policy account worth can never shed cash due to a down market. Indexed global life insurance policy assurances your account value, locking in gains from each year, called a yearly reset.
In investing, you make money to take risk. If you do not want to take much danger, don't anticipate high returns. IUL account worths grow tax-deferred like a qualified strategy (individual retirement account and 401(k)); shared funds do not unless they are held within a qualified plan. Basically, this indicates that your account worth benefits from three-way compounding: You make interest on your principal, you earn passion on your interest and you make rate of interest accurate you would certainly or else have actually paid in tax obligations on the rate of interest.
Although certified plans are a much better option than non-qualified strategies, they still have concerns absent with an IUL. Financial investment selections are generally restricted to common funds where your account worth undergoes wild volatility from direct exposure to market threat. There is a big difference in between a tax-deferred retirement account and an IUL, however Mr.
You spend in one with pre-tax bucks, reducing this year's tax expense at your minimal tax obligation rate (and will commonly be able to withdraw your money at a reduced reliable rate later on) while you spend in the other with after-tax dollars and will certainly be required to pay interest to borrow your very own money if you do not want to give up the policy.
Then he includes the timeless IUL salesman scare technique of "wild volatility." If you dislike volatility, there are much better ways to lower it than by purchasing an IUL, like diversification, bonds or low-beta stocks. There are no limitations on the quantity that might be contributed annually to an IUL.
Why would the government put limitations on just how much you can put right into retirement accounts? Possibly, just maybe, it's due to the fact that they're such a terrific bargain that the government does not want you to save as well much on taxes.
